Your Role: Mechanic Engine Inspection (Incoming/Outgoing)

Join our team as a Mechanic in Engine Inspection and play a crucial role in ensuring the safety and performance of aircraft engines. Your key responsibilities will include:

  • Preparation of Pratt & Whitney PW4000 and CFM International CFM56 engines for maintenance, including unwrapping and de-preservation.
  • Handling of Pratt & Whitney PW4000 and CFM International CFM56 engines between ship stands, pedestals, and trailers in accordance with the manufacturer's manuals.
  • Performing incoming inspections of Pratt & Whitney PW4000 and CFM International CFM56 engines as per the manufacturer's manuals and reporting findings to engineering.
  • Conducting outgoing inspections of Pratt & Whitney PW4000 and CFM International CFM56 engines according to the manufacturer's manuals and initiating corrective actions if needed.
  • Documenting installed engine components using the Vocollect System.
  • Executing tasks in a timely manner and maintaining self-control over performed orders.
  • Documenting activities assigned in accordance with regulations.
  • Continuously improving executed processes to enhance quality and reduce production costs.
